Chilly Day Soup
A warm, comforting soup with sweet carrots and creamy potato flavor, perfect for chilly days. Its smooth texture and hearty taste make it ideal for family dinners.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Melt butter or oleo in a saucepan.
- Add the finely chopped onions and grated carrots, cover, and simmer for 20 minutes.
- Stir in the cream of potato soup, milk, celery salt, salt, and pepper.
- Heat until the soup reaches serving temperature.
Tips & Substitutions
For a deeper flavor, consider adding minced garlic or a bay leaf while the onions and carrots simmer. If you're out of cream of potato soup, you can substitute it with cream of mushroom or a homemade potato puree. To add some heat, a dash of cayenne pepper can elevate this soup's flavor profile. Storage &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. When reheating, do so gently on the stove over low heat,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king. If the soup thickens too much, add a splash of milk to achieve your desired consistency before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this soup vegetarian?
Yes, this soup is easily adaptable to vegetarian diets. Ensure you use vegetable broth instead of any meat-based options and verify that your cream of potato soup is vegetarian-friendly. This way, you can enjoy a delicious bowl while sticking to vegetarian recipes.
How can I make this soup creamier?
To enhance the creaminess, you can add an extra cup of milk or a splash of heavy cream when you stir in the soup. Blending a portion of the soup can also create a smoother texture. Experiment with these options to achieve your perfect consistency.
What can I add to make this soup more filling?
To make the soup more substantial, consider adding cooked diced potatoes or even some cooked grains like quinoa or rice. These additions will not only make the soup heartier but also increase its nutritional value, making it a satisfying meal.
